Location Rensselaer, New York Start date Apr 13, 2026 categoriesView less categories Job Details Company Job Details We are looking to add a Supervisor Process Maintenance to our growing team working a Wednesday-Saturday 2:00pm-12:30am schedule. This role primarily oversees the operations of the Large Scale 10k process area maintenance functions. As a Supervisor Process Maintenance, a typical day might include the following: Planning and scheduling maintenance repairs/modifications of facility and process equipment. Troubleshooting process equipment problems and making required changes. Advising supervision of Regeneron Process Maintenance Technicians and Process Maintenance Leads to high performance goals in a c
GMP - FDA
regulated environment. Leading team in continuous improvement, 5S, and Lean initiatives. Coaching, counseling and managing performance of a team. Reviewing departmental operations and recommending changes to management. Forecasting resource requirements and submitting budget recommendations to management. Supervising, coordinating and assuring compliance with contractors and Regeneron employees on all applicable codes and standards. Supporting Deviation Management process including NOE, EOE and DNF investigations and reviews. This position might be for you if you: Have at least 3 years of leadership experience. Consistently demonstrate adept interpersonal and communication abilities as a leader and provide thoughtful and decisive decision making. Have a strong attention to detail including experience with budgeting management. Are able to see the Big Picture and demonstrate the ability to respond accordingly. Ensure the highest level of customer service for both internal and external customers. Are skilled in the use of Microsoft office applications (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Visio and Project) and other related software. To be considered for the Supervisor Production Maintenance position, you should have an AS in engineering, science or related field and 5+ years experience in pharmaceutical production operations for aseptic formulations, filling and lyophilization.
